How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Reno?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Reno Studio Apartments | $1,406 | $725 | $3,239 |
| Reno 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,789 | $825 | $7,138 |
| Reno 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,066 | $875 | $7,990 |
| Reno 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,318 | $800 | $7,447 |
| Reno 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,655 | $665 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Reno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Reno?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Reno is at Bethel Plaza listed at $500.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Reno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Reno is $1,923.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Reno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Reno is a 1,991 square feet unit starting from $5,159 at 6511 Enchanted Valley Dr.
What is the average size for Reno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Reno is currently at 667 sq ft.
